Please help with the image!! Use the Exterior Angle Theorem to find the measure of each angle. 83 points!!!!!!

Mathematics
2 answers:
Andrej [43]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

Step-by-step explanation:

solve E 1st as its the easiest -

<E + 113deg = 180deg

<E = 180 - 113 = 67deg

by exterior angle theorem, <C + <D = 113deg

so 3y+5 + 7y+8 = 113

10y=100

y=10

<C = 3(10)+5 = 35deg

<D = 7(10)+8 = 78deg

The objective is to state whether or not the following limit exists

                                \lim_{x \to -2}  \frac{3(2x-1)^2 - 75}{x+2}.

First, we simplify the expression in the numerator of the fraction.

3(2x-1)^2 -75 = 3(4x^2 - 4x +1) -75 = 12x^2 - 12x + 3 - 75 = 12x^2 - 12x -72

Now, we obtain

                         12(x^2-x-6) = 12(x+2)(x-3)

and the fraction is transformed into

                       \frac{3(2x-1)^2 - 75}{x+2} =  \frac{12(x+2)(x-3)}{x+2} = 12 (x-3)

Therefore, the following limit is

       \lim_{x \to -2}  \frac{3(2x-1)^2 - 75}{x+2} = \lim_{x \to -2}  12(x-3) = 12 \lim_{x \to -2} (x-3)

You can plug in -2 in the equation, hence

                        12 \lim_{x \to -2} (x-3) = 12 (-2-3) = -60
